Rathmoy Estate North Efate 1891The ‘Tanna Coffee’ plantation is located at 400m above sea level, with a mean average temperature of 18 degrees C and average annual rainfall of 2500mm, it is perfectly suited for growing only the purest Arabica Coffee utilizing the semi-dwarf Catimor varieties, which are hybrids developed from some of the worlds finest coffee stock. The deep rich volcanic soils of Tanna Island are both highly fertile and free draining, with a PH level on the plantation of between 5.7 and 6.4. The rich fertile soils and a pest-free environment (in conjunction with a natural bio-control program and the abundant leguminous cover crops), ensures that Tanna Island is ideal for growing the purest organic coffee in a sustainable, non-harmful manner.Rathmoy Estate North Efate 1891

A new Coffee Development Programme was launched some 4 years ago to increase the quality, quantity and productivity of the smallholder farmers and to provide maximum value-addition to their income. To date through the CDP, there has been around 300,000 trees planted on Tanna alone and a further 50,000 planted on other adjoining islands. This has culminated in a four-fold increase in production and with technical training programmes, it has ensured that an optimum quality and freshness is strictly maintained throughout the entire process, from the plantation to the cup. Tanna Coffee is 100% Organically Grown & is currently organizing certification through Certenz (New Zealand), as well as Fair Trade labeling through FLO.
